Structural geology uses micro- and meso-scale structures found in the rocks to elaborate tools and methods enabling to identify structures too large to be directly observed, although satellite imagery now may help in this task. Geologic structures influence the shape of the landscape, determine the degree of landslide hazard, bring old rocks to the surface, bury young rocks, trap petroleum and natural gas, shift during earthquakes, and channel fluids that create economic deposits of metals such as gold and silver. The primary goal of structural geology is to use measurements of present-day rock geometries to uncover information about the history of deformation in the rocks, and ultimately, to understand the stress field that resulted in the observed strain and geometries. If the resulting fold is trough-shaped, the structure is called a syncline. Geologic structures are usually the result of the powerful tectonic forces that occur within the earth. Geological structures can significantly influence the porosity and permeability of aquifer materials as well as groundwater movement and accumulation in the surface and subsurface (Ayazi et al., 2010; Ghorbani Nejad et al., 2017).It is important to consider such factors in groundwater studies.
